UNSHAKABLE FAITH : Booker T. Washington & George Washington Carver
Perry, John
Multnomah Press, 1999
387 pages

Here are biographical profiles of two Christian African American men who suffered from slavery’s manifold abuses and were inextricably bound together in the launching of Tuskegee Institute in the late 1800s. Washington, founder of Tuskegee, recruited Carver to join him in its early days. Launching an educational institution for poor blacks in rural Alabama that challenged them daily, they broke racial and economic stereotypes, served a disenfranchised people, raised money from Northerners, grew the food needed by the school and tested each other’s attitudes. Perry writes with compassion without hiding the rough edges of each man’s personality and genius.
